By Cris Alarcon, InEDC Writer. (May 20, 2025)

PLACERVILLE, Calif. — El Dorado County will host a grand opening ceremony for the long-awaited Missouri Flat Road Bike/Pedestrian Overcrossing on Saturday, May 31, 2025, in a public event designed to celebrate increased trail safety and regional connectivity. The event begins with a free family-friendly community bike ride along the El Dorado Trail, culminating in a ribbon-cutting ceremony at the new overcrossing.

The event is a collaboration between the El Dorado County Parks and Trails Division, the El Dorado County Transportation Commission, and the Friends of El Dorado Trail, and aims to raise awareness about trail safety and active transportation.

Participants are invited to gather at 8:30 a.m. at the Ray Lawyer Park & Ride Parking Lot on Forni Road. The bike ride will proceed along the El Dorado Trail to the Old Depot Bike Park, arriving at the overcrossing for the official ceremony from 9:30 to 10:00 a.m.

The Missouri Flat Overcrossing is a key piece in El Dorado County’s vision to improve non-motorized travel options and enhance safety by separating pedestrians and cyclists from vehicle traffic along the busy commercial corridor.

“This project represents years of planning and community collaboration,” said Amanda Ross, Parks and Trails Program Manager.

“It’s a huge step toward safer, more connected recreational and commuting options for our residents.”

The overcrossing connects previously segmented portions of the El Dorado Trail, a popular multi-use trail spanning the county from Placerville to Camino and beyond. The infrastructure upgrade is especially significant for families, cyclists, and walkers seeking uninterrupted access to scenic and recreational areas.
